Title: carbon express "reinforcements"
Post by: bob@helleknife.com on July 30, 2008, 01:16:00 PM
I need to reinforce the front end of some Carbon Express 250s.

I am going to exoxy an inch or so of a 2315 over the end; the fit is a bit loose.

Is there a better way?  Or another size shaft that will give me a tighter fit?

Thanks,

Bob
Title: Re: carbon express "reinforcements"
Post by: BobW on July 30, 2008, 01:20:00 PM
2216 fits 250's the way you want.... I suggest JB Weld.

Title: Re: carbon express "reinforcements"
Post by: M60gunner on July 30, 2008, 07:10:00 PM
Hi Norb, I used 2112 over my CE 150's. I used 2213 over my CE 250's and 1917 (JD grey) over my Axis 400 and 500's.
I use golf club expoy that I got at a pro shop in San Marcos. The downside to this expoy is it is forever. The brand name is:The Golf works, shafting expoy. 1-800-848-8358.

Title: Re: carbon express "reinforcements"
Post by: SHOOTO8S on July 31, 2008, 02:06:00 PM
I don't think all the Heritage shafts are the same circumference...heres the OD's per Carbon Express


SPECS
Heritage  
Model  Size/Qty Grs/Inch* Spine Diameter
SHAFT  
W1410  90/12pk†  9.4 0.530" 0.291"
W1402  150/12pk  10 0.487" 0.300"
W1400  250/12pk  11 0.373" 0.305"
W1401  350/12pk  12 0.320" 0.309
